Jack Ryan never had the Senate seat. He was the Republican candidate, Barack Obama was the Democratic candidate. They were in the midst of the campaign when the Chicago Tribune sued to have Jack & Jeri's custody child custody files opened. The Trib won, the heavily redacted files were released, and Jack dropped out of the race to be replaced by carpetbagger Alan Keyes, and Obama won handily.

The issue with Jeri's costume was with the Borg get-up--which was certainly just as bad as anything the Klingon actors or Neelix had to go through.

And it was a design defect that caused her problems. The Borg costumes are developed by doing a full body cast of the actor to produce the rubber costume. When they produced the rubber costume, they forgot to take into account the bald cap which fits under the neck.

This made the neck too tight and cut off the blood flow to her brain through the carotid artery. Guess what happens when you cut the blood flow through the carotid? You have a stroke.

Surely you're not going to argue that a preventable stroke for a 29 year-old is "part of the bargain"?

When the costumers realized what the problem was, they adjusted the costume. This is part of their job--to make prosthetics as safe and comfortable as possible for the actors wearing them.
